Chris Noth reveals what led to ‘hurtful’ friendship fallout with Sarah Jessica Parker after taking wild dig at SATC star

Chris Noth cemented his status as a major TV star with his role as Carrie Bradshaw’s on/off boyfriend Mr. Big on HBO’s hit series Sex And The City.

The former Law & Order star had a recurring role on the show between 1998 and 2004 and went on to co-star in two spinoff films in 2008 and 2010.

But now, he confirmed in a preview of his upcoming appearance on the Really Famous with Kara Mayer Robinson podcast, he no longer has any contact with his former costar Sarah Jessica Parker, who played Bradshaw.

‘We’re not friends – I think that’s pretty obvious,’ Noth, 71, said, according to the preview obtained by People on Wednesday. 

The falling out between the pair came after he was accused of sexual assault by multiple women in late 2021 and shared that in the wake of the allegations, he felt abandoned by Parker.

Noth said he and Parker’s falling out came after she made a joint statement in December of 2021 with their SATC castmates Kristin Davis and Cynthia Nixon regarding the allegations against him.

At the time, Parker, Nixon and Davis said they were ‘deeply saddened’ and showed public support for ‘the women who have come forward and shared their painful experiences.’

Noth told Robinson that it was ‘disappointing’ to see his once close friends and co-stars seemingly turn their back on him.

‘The statement that they put out — which was nothing more than brand management, really — I don’t know, it was sad, it was disappointing, it was surprising,’ he said.  

‘Because you need to call me and hear my side of this. You’ve known me for many years, and we’ve worked [together] for many years.’

‘I get it, that’s more Hollywood than Hollywood. But before you make that statement, you know me, you’ve known me all these years, give me a call so I can give you the real scoop about this.

‘And that didn’t happen, and that was too bad,’ said Noth, who played Mr. Big on Sex and the City and the reboot And Just Like That. (The character was killed off via a heart attack in the wake of the allegations against Noth.)

Looking back, Noth said on the podcast that there were key lessons learned from the situation and that he now knows who his ‘real friends are.’

‘What’s gained is good. You know where people stand and you know who your real friends are and who they’re not.

‘That’s important to know. I just know if it had been on the other hand, I wouldn’t have done that.’

Noth said of the treatment from his SATC co-stars, ‘That was hurtful, and it really affected everything.’

Noth was in the headlines earlier this month after he acknowledged his disenchantment with Parker in response to a social media user.

Noth posted a gym selfie on January 9 with the caption ‘F&@k new years – LETS GO!!!!’ – two days after Parker had been the recipient of the 2026 Carol Burnett Award at a Golden Globes-adjacent event.

A user then replied to the actor, ‘You mean f*** SJP & her award right? lol,’ to which Noth wrote, ‘Right’ in response – touching off speculation from fans of the HBO franchise.

After his one-word response generated a considerable reaction, Noth said he was distancing himself from any controversy, and the reaction was overblown.  

‘My off the cuff slightly sarcastic response to a comment on the internet seems to have caused a tempest in a teapot,’ Noth said on Instagram. ‘It is not news. It is not worth all this discussion. 

‘It is a waste of time in a world where there are more important things to worry about.’

The scandal kicked off in late 2021 when two unnamed women accused the actor of sexual assaults in 2004 and 2015 in a piece for The Hollywood Reporter

Noth in 2021 issued a statement denying any wrongdoing, saying, ‘The accusations against me made by individuals I met years, even decades, ago are categorically false.

‘These stories could’ve been from 30 years ago or 30 days ago – no always means no – that is a line I did not cross. The encounters were consensual.’

Noth faced professional consequences in the wake of the allegations, as he was fired from his role on the CBS crime drama The Equalizer, and scenes set to air on the finale of And Just Like That… were removed.

Noth in August of 2023 said he never sexually assaulted anyone, but confessed to stepping out on his marriage to wife Tara Wilson, 43. They are parents to two sons, Orion, 18, and Keats, five.

‘I strayed on my wife, and it’s devastating to her and not a very pretty picture,’ the actor told USA Today. ‘What it isn’t is a crime.’

While no criminal charges were filed against the actor, he said he felt it had a massive impact on the way he was perceived by the public following the series of events.

Noth told the newspaper, ‘There’s nothing I can say to change anyone’s mind when you have that kind of a tidal wave. It sounds defensive. I’m not.

‘There’s no criminal court. There’s no criminal trial. There’s nothing for me to get on the stand about and get my story out, get witnesses.

He added, ‘And there’s even more absurd add-ons that are completely ridiculous, that have absolutely no basis in fact.’
